    I really like Dundee but have only started visiting fairly recently. Prior to that it was always somewhere we stopped for a quick snack before heading on to Glasgow or Edinburgh. For my 11 year old, she loves the shopping as we do let her loose by herself (which is not something I would allow in Glasgow or Edinburgh, too big) and I like the culture. The Discovery and the V&A are right next to each and good for a visit. The HMS Unicorn is also worth a visit and we have enjoyed the Science Centre and Camperdown Park previously. There are some lovely pubs and restaurants, I have never met any rude staff, they are always so lovely and friendly. Highly recommend a wee visit.
